Combat was more than a necessity, it was a way of life. And Juzo was all but too ready to disregard the passive environment he found himself dealing with in the Medical Branch. It had seemed like far too many among his "peers" were against such acts of violent. Which he found both perplexing and naive. But it was hardly his job to correct their mistake. For now he would enjoy himself with some prearranged battles. The Academy offered to pair up shinobi who simply wanted to hone their skills, which was a great convenience to the anti-social Juzo. Though it always felt strange to walk back onto the Academy. While Juzo knew it was a place for education it felt like somewhere only young children should be. Or perhaps Juzo felt slightly self-conscious. Either way he pushed the thought from his head through willpower alone. There was no room for self-doubt.
It was already later in the day and he had scheduled time at around 7:30PM, so he had to be quick about arriving at the fighting area on time. Being a man obsesses with punctuality, he arrived a few minutes before the appointed time and checked in.
"Juzo, here for my 7:30." He said in a dry tone before following up with a piercing stare. The reception, or secretary, or whatever she was seemed totally unaffected by the exchange as she got the information for him. The small card she handed back told him everything. He would be the more experienced fighter in this challenge and it was requested he not hold back too much. The sparring partner was apparently quite adept and just needed additional guidance in how to control the tide of battle.
Juzo smirked and headed to the open area for the fight. He had been wise and requested an arena with tons of shadow and randomly distributed items to use as cover. It was his own preferred terrain but he knew any decent shinobi could also make use of the additional sources of shelter. For now he would wait.
